JERSEY CITY, N.J. — New York City-based developer Namdar Group has secured $390 million in financing for Park Tower, a 1,049-unit, transit-oriented, mixed-income development in Jersey City’s Journal Square neighborhood. A start date was not announced. Completion is slated for May 2029. Park Tower adds to Namdar’s extensive Journal Square portfolio, where the developer has delivered more than 2,000 apartments as part of a multi-year buildout around the neighborhood’s PATH station. The PATH train provides direct access to the World Trade Center in Lower Manhattan.
Affinius Capital provided a $310 million construction loan, and BH3 Management contributed an $80 million mezzanine loan. Walker & Dunlop arranged both pieces of financing.
C3D Architecture designed the property, which is comprised of studios, one-, two- and three-bedroom units with in-unit washers and dryers and views of the New York City skyline. Amenities include a fitness center, yoga studio, bowling alley, arcade, music room, golf simulator, game room and a rooftop lounge. The project also will feature 105 affordable housing units, 30 extended-stay hotel units and ground-floor retail.
